TitleLetter from R N Moffat, Uganda Protectorate, Entebbe, to Robert [William Frederick] Harrison, Assistant Secretary of the Royal Society
Date21 January 1904
Description'Sir, I am in receipt of your communication dated December 18th, 1903. In reply I would ask you to convey to the Council of the Royal Society my appreciation of the honour they have conferred upon me in appointing me an accessory member of the Tropical Diseases Committee. I shall of course me pleased to do anything that lies in my power to assist the Committee. I am Sir, Your obedient servant, R N Moffat'.
